Understanding SEN Special Education: Providing Support For Every Child

SEN Special Education, short for Special Educational Needs Special Education, refers to the specialized education programs and support services provided to children with special educational needs These needs can range from learning disabilities, physical disabilities, emotional or behavioral disorders, to sensory impairments and developmental delays The aim of SEN Special Education is to ensure that every child receives an education tailored to their unique needs and abilities, so they can reach their full potential.

In the past, children with special educational needs were often marginalized or excluded from mainstream education However, with the introduction of inclusive education policies and laws, there has been a shift towards a more inclusive approach that promotes the participation and equality of all children, regardless of their abilities SEN Special Education plays a crucial role in this inclusive education framework, providing the necessary support and accommodations to help children with special educational needs thrive in school.

One of the key principles of SEN Special Education is the concept of individualized education plans (IEPs) IEPs are personalized plans that outline a child’s specific needs, goals, and the support services they require to succeed academically These plans are developed collaboratively by a team of professionals, including teachers, parents, and specialists, to ensure that the child’s educational needs are met effectively By tailoring education to each child’s unique needs, IEPs help create a supportive learning environment that fosters their growth and development.

Another important aspect of SEN Special Education is the provision of specialized support services These services can include speech therapy, occupational therapy, behavioral therapy, counseling, and assistive technology, among others These services are designed to address the specific needs of children with disabilities and provide them with the tools and resources they need to overcome their challenges By integrating these support services into the educational setting, SEN Special Education helps children with special educational needs access a comprehensive range of interventions to support their learning and development.
